But what impact does this type of material have on our sexual imagination and intimacy?
To begin with, erotic stories can provide a safe and accessible way to explore our deepest desires and fantasies. Unlike pornography, which often focuses on explicit visuals, erotic literature allows readers to use their imagination to fill in the gaps and create a more personal and intimate experience. This can be especially appealing to those who may feel uncomfortable or intimidated by visual forms of adult entertainment.
Moreover, erotic literature can also serve as a tool for improving communication and intimacy in romantic relationships. By discussing and sharing erotic stories with a partner, couples can gain a better understanding of each other’s desires and fantasies, and can use this knowledge to enhance their own sexual experiences. Additionally, the act of reading erotic literature together can be a fun and intimate activity that can help to strengthen the bond between partners.
However, it’s important to note that erotic literature is not without its potential downsides. Like any form of adult entertainment, it’s possible to become overly reliant on erotic stories as a means of achieving sexual satisfaction. Additionally, some people may find that certain types of erotic literature can lead to unrealistic expectations about sex and relationships.
It’s also important to consider the potential impact of erotic literature on young adults and children. While it’s unlikely that young people will seek out this type of material, it’s still possible for them to stumble upon it, and the impact of such exposure is not yet fully understood.
In conclusion, erotic literature can be a powerful tool for exploring our sexual imagination and improving intimacy in romantic relationships. However, like any form of adult entertainment, it’s important to use it responsibly and in moderation. It’s also crucial to consider the potential impact of erotic literature on young people and to take steps to protect them from inappropriate material.
